5” Charm Square Swap #49 USA

01/03/16 thru 01-27-16

5” Charm square = a 5”X5” cut of 100% cotton fabric (no paper thin fabric)

2 partners to receive: 20 five inch charms each (that is a total of 40 charms sent with up to 2 a like to each partner)

This swap is senders’ choice on color prints to send. You can send up to 2 charms alike only. Be sure to measure and cut accurately. Do not send paper-thin fabric.

Newbies are welcome with a 5 rating and 3 snail-mail swaps to their credit. I do check profiles before I assign partners and I reserve the right to remove participants.

Seasoned swappers must have a 4.8 rating and no “1’s” in the last 6 months.

Helpful note: If concerned about postage on this swap please note that if you do not send the charms in one stack in a regular letter sized envelope (stacked and bulky) you can save postage. Spread them out so that you have 2 or 3 charms in a stack and that makes the postage priced at letter rates instead of package rates. If you put them in a 9X5 3/4 inch envelope or maybe even a larger envelope then you will only need 2 or 3 stamps for an approximate postage bill of $1.47. I usually send more than 20 charms to each partner or even extra cuts of fabric so my postage is usually more than $1.47.
